The MagnaFlow California Grade Direct-Fit Catalytic Converter is a high-quality emissions control component designed for the Dodge Dakota 3.7L models from 2007 to 2009. Constructed from highly corrosion-resistant stainless steel, this converter features free-flowing mandrel-bent tubing to optimize exhaust flow and reduce backpressure. Its spun body design ensures durability and a precise fit, while the California Grade CARB-compliant certification allows for legal use in California and other states with strict emissions regulations. The converter is engineered to keep the check engine light off by effectively converting harmful exhaust gases, contributing to improved vehicle performance and environmental compliance. MagnaFlow’s advanced 3D metrology ensures precise manufacturing, providing confidence in fitment and longevity.
This direct-fit catalytic converter is designed specifically for 2007-2009 Dodge Dakota models equipped with the 3.7L engine. It offers a straightforward installation process that requires no cutting or welding, making it suitable for DIY enthusiasts and professional installers alike.
